Foundation donors were thanked and celebrated for their generosity and community commitment over lunch at the Jewish Community Center of Greater New Haven on November 13, 2019. Photos by Judy Sirota Rosenthal

Community Foundation Board Chair Dr. Khalilah Brown-Dean and President & CEO Will Ginsberg thanked and celebrated donors' generosity and community commitment over lunch at the JCC of Greater New Haven, beautifully restored after a 2016 fire. The venue was particularly fitting for the message about the value of a diverse community united through shared values, a shared past and a sense of common destiny. The Foundation is proud to have provided support this year for safety and security enhancements at the JCC.

In his remarks, Ginsberg shared, "In this age of widening inequality and deep division, we at The Community Foundation are looking anew at how we can help to sustain the sense of community in Greater New Haven and use it productively to create a common agenda for our common future. ... One idea keeps pushing its way to the front of our thinking: Opportunity."

In September, The Foundation convened a remarkably diverse group of area residents to talk about how we can capitalize on our assets more effectively to create growth, and how we can ensure that that growth creates opportunity for people at all levels along the socio-economic spectrum and in all towns and neighborhoods in our region.
